The static between Helio and Carlson is well documented! This really came to a head with Wallid Ismael, who in BJJ competition had wins over many of the Helio side of the family including the historic Wallid vs Royce Gracie match in which Wallid put Royce to sleep with a clock choke.
Carlson Gracie put together a very impressive team of NHBG/Vale Tudo early on. The list is a who's who of Brazilian NHB/Vale tudo standouts including:
Mario Sperry
Murillo Bustamante
Romero "Jacare" Calvancanti
Allan Goes
Vitor Belfort
Fabio Gurgel
Marcelo Behring (this is who the Yamasaki brothers, my instructors, received their BBs from actually)
Ironically, it was Carlson who was credited with "inventing" the sport of BJJ. He is credited with coming up with the rule sets of todays BJJ competitiongs. This is one of the things that drove the wedge even further between him and Helio Gracie.
